Health Sciences Firm Promotes Four

Washington – E4H Environments for Health Architecture, a healthcare and health sciences firm, recently announced four promotions.

John Gillham, AIA, NCARB, has been promoted to associate partner. Gillham leads the N.Y. office’s Health Science initiatives and coordinates office staffing and future planning.

Gillham brings significant experience in diverse healthcare project types, including clinical laboratories, research laboratories, master planning, offices, and treatment area renovations.

Nan Schramm, EDAC, LEED GA, Fitwel Ambassador, has been promoted to associate partner. Schramm is involved in all Washington D.C. based projects and is responsible for all phases of experiential design and interior design projects. Her recent work endeavors include several hospital finish standards packages, hematology and oncology, ambulatory care, women’s care, patient unit refreshes and medical office building fit-outs. 

Allison Dar, AIA, LEED AP, EDAC, has been promoted to senior associate. Over the years she has enjoyed designing a wide variety of healthcare projects throughout large hospital and outpatient facilities. Within the Washington D..C office, she is responsible for the programming, planning, design, coordination, and construction administration of her projects. 

Julissa Tellez, Associate AIA, EDAC, has been promoted to associate. Tellez delivers value to every engagement, often starting by helping clients better understand their own needs. Based in Dallas, she is versed in a wide range of projects in the for-profit and not-for-profit sector, including master planning, renovations, additions, community and neighborhood hospitals, greenfield construction, and tenant re-characterization.
